Summary[edit] Description: Those little beetles (~2mm) chose the "game stones" (Awale game) I had substituted with nutmeg for feeding, living & propagating. The population in just 7 nutmeg seeds was more than 40 individuals and some larvae. For more info: en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lasioderma_serricorne Phylum: Arthropoda Class: Insecta (insects, Insekten) Order: Coleoptera (beetles, Käfer) Suborder: Polyphaga Infraorder: Bostrichiformia Superfamily: Bostrichoidea Family: Anobiidae FLEMING, 1821 ("wood borer, Nagekäfer oder Pochkäfer) Subfamily: Xyletininae Lasioderma serricorne (tobacco beetle, Tabakkäfer) Indonesia, W-Java: vic.
